I received a Sony PSP-3000 as a birthday gift. For two weeks I fought to make the PSP connect to my Wi-Fi as stated per Sony. I have a better than average wireless router.

It is a Linksys E2000 N router, up to networking standards. After fooling with it for two weeks. I contacted Sonny aka SCEA tech support. Spoke to Elvis, after going over troubleshooting. He placed me on hold came back ant told me that the PSP does not work with the N rated routers. It was a problem Sony knew about and never fixed. Nor did they advise future customers of the issue. I contacted the HQ of SCEA in CA. Spoke to a Jan, who explained that they were aware of the issue and did nothing to fix or make customer aware of the problem. I was given three options: 1) Buy another/different router (i.e. a b/g rated), 2) goes to a Wi-Fi hotspot like McDonalds, Starbucks or 3) adjust the parameters of my router overtime I want to use the PSP. I now have a $139.09 paper weight, due to the failure of Sony not providing proper info on packaging and website. I have names, numbers, time and dates.
